Mr. SIMPSON. Mr. Speaker, I am honored to rise today alongside my esteemed colleagues, Senator Mike Crapo and Senator James E. Risch, to commend the students and staff of Canyon Ridge High School for their outstanding achievement in being named a National Banner School by Special Olympics. This recognition is a testament to the school's unwavering dedication to fostering a welcoming environment where all students, regardless of ability, are valued.
Canyon Ridge High School has demonstrated a commitment to excellence by meeting and surpassing the ten standards necessary to receive this prestigious award. Through the implementation of a three-component model, which includes Special Olympics Unified Sports, strong youth leadership, and whole school engagement, Canyon Ridge High School has truly set a high bar for education.
The school's commitment to Unified Sports, where students with and without intellectual disabilities play on the same team, is exceptional. From soccer in the fall, to basketball and bowling in the winter, and track and pickleball in the spring, these sports serve as a shining example of bringing people together.
Furthermore, Canyon Ridge High School's Student Council has shown outstanding leadership by planning the 2022 Junior Prom, decorating the school for every holiday, planning assemblies, service projects, and other school-wide activities. The ``Take the Lead'' class, which allows students of all abilities to create a senior-like ``passion project,'' is yet another example of the school's commitment to fostering leadership and empowerment among its students.
Finally, Canyon Ridge High School's whole school engagement efforts ensure that every student is part of the school's culture. From the ``Pennies for Possibilities'' service project to the school-wide assemblies that recognize the Unified Sports players and the ``HAWK'' Awards, all students are given the opportunity to feel valued and respected.
Mr. Speaker, I join my colleagues in commending the students and staff at Canyon Ridge High School for their tireless efforts in achieving this tremendous honor. They have truly set the standard for empowering education, and we are proud to recognize their achievement today.
